Output 59cd72e8f25c04bbfbd8bcfc1deaa63cbaf4aaecf06a3bfbf9183f64957dd006:23

value
16626053
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d317cd6770141539df33cb8957ae9db3c0348bb OP_EQUAL
address
35oycdxzHA91J1Wt5d43cksCZsnqWPXgAw
transaction
59cd72e8f25c04bbfbd8bcfc1deaa63cbaf4aaecf06a3bfbf9183f64957dd006
spent
true